WebWhen used before a noun as an adjective, use '' -year-old": A ten-year-old boy is sitting on the couch. When you simply state the age of someone, write "years old" and do not hyphenate: The boy sitting on the couch is 10 years old. Note, in this case, you can omit the part "years old" : He is 10. = He is 10 years old.
